Patria Investments Limited operates as a private market investment firm focused on investing in Latin America. The company offers asset management services to investors focusing on private equity funds, infrastructure development funds, co-investments funds, constructivist equity funds, and real estate and credit funds. Patria Investments Limited was founded in 1994 and is headquartered in Grand Cayman, the Cayman Islands.

2024 Annual Earnings Highlights

Key Highlights

Total AUM Reaches 41.9B USD Total AUM grew by 10.1B USD to 41.9B USD by year-end 2024, driven by acquisitions and positive performance.
FEAUM Increased 9.0B USD Fee Earning AUM grew 9.0B USD to 32.9B USD in 2024, reflecting strong recurring revenue base expansion.
Net Revenue Services Up 14.2% Net revenue from services reached 374.2M USD in 2024, marking a 14.2% increase, primarily from management fees.
Platform Diversification Strategy Platform now offers over 35 investment strategies across asset classes, fueled by major acquisitions completed during 2024.

Risk Factors

Macroeconomic Volatility Risks Operations highly exposed to political/economic instability in Latin America, impacting market conditions and asset valuations.
Financing Cost Sensitivity Increased interest rates negatively impact ability of funds and portfolio companies to obtain attractive financing or refinancing.
Net Income Declined 37.3% Net income for the year fell 45.1M USD to 75.7M USD in 2024, despite revenue growth, due to higher expenses.

Outlook

Fixed Dividend Policy Adopted Transitioned to fixed quarterly dividend of $0.15 per share starting Q2 2024, subject to annual review for flexibility.
Continue Inorganic Growth Plan to expand platform via acquisitions and strategic partnerships to enhance capabilities outside Latin America.
Share Repurchase Program Board approved plan to repurchase up to 1.8M Class A common shares through June 2025 to enhance shareholder returns.
Expand Global Investor Reach Focus on growing client base beyond large institutions, targeting HNW and local institutional investors for diversification.
